In 1860 What was the population of the United states including slaves

It would be 31,443,321 people 3,953,760 were slaves.

Many historians have argued that the conditions represented in the novel The Jungle were caused by
Hatshy [7]
#1) Many historians have argued that the conditions represented in the novel The Jungle were caused by
Answer: Corrupt Economic System. The book depicts working class poverty, the lack of social supports, harsh and unpleasant living and working conditions, and a hopelessness among many workers. These elements are contrasted with the deeply rooted corruption of people in power.
